MySQL多核优化是指通过配置和优化MySQL数据库,使其能够充分利用多核处理器的优势,提高数据库的性能和并发处理能力。多核处理器可以同时执行多个任务,通过合理分配任务到不同的核心上,可以显著提升数据库的响应速度和处理能力。
innodb_thread_concurrency
、innodb_read_io_threads
等,以充分利用多核处理器的优势。原因:
解决方法:
EXPLAIN
分析查询计划,确保查询能够并行执行。原因:
解决方法:
EXPLAIN
分析查询计划,找出性能瓶颈。-- 创建一个示例表
CREATE TABLE example_table (
id INT PRIMARY KEY,
name VARCHAR(255),
age INT
);
-- 插入一些示例数据
INSERT INTO example_table (id, name, age) VALUES
(1, 'Alice', 30),
(2, 'Bob', 25),
(3, 'Charlie', 35);
-- 查询示例
SELECT * FROM example_table WHERE age > 25;
通过上述配置和优化方法,可以显著提升MySQL在多核处理器环境下的性能和并发处理能力。
领取专属 10元无门槛券
手把手带您无忧上云